#' Merge two lists and overwrite latter entries with former entries
#' if names are the same.
#'
#' For example, \code{list_merge(list(a = 1, b = 2), list(b = 3, c = 4))}
#' will be \code{list(a = 1, b = 3, c = 4)}.
#' @param list1 list
#' @param list2 list
#' @return the merged list.
#' @export
#' @examples
#' stopifnot(identical(list_merge(list(a = 1, b = 2), list(b = 3, c = 4)),
#' list(a = 1, b = 3, c = 4)))
#' stopifnot(identical(list_merge(NULL, list(a = 1)), list(a = 1)))
list_merge <- function(list1, list2) {
list1 <- list1 %||% list()
# Pre-allocate memory to make this slightly faster.
list1[Filter(function(x) nchar(x) > 0, names(list2) %||% c())] <- NULL
for (i in seq_along(list2)) {
name <- names(list2)[i]
if (!identical(name, NULL) && !identical(name, "")) list1[[name]] <- list2[[i]]
else list1 <- append(list1, list(list2[[i]]))
}
list1
}
`%||%` <- function(x, y) if (is.null(x)) y else x
